What does 'enable the macros' mean????

2 replies

suwoo · 20/01/2009 21:17

I have to complete an excel report daily for work. On each spreadsheet, I have to 'enable the macros'. It annoys me that I have to do this each time and I am curious what it means?
Ta.

OP posts:
onager · 20/01/2009 21:22

You can probably avoid having to do that by adjusting the overall security level.

Roughly speaking Macros are little programs (scripts) that run to do small tasks. Since people found a way to make malicious ones like viruses it's not advisable to open strange documents with the security off. If it's always just your own docs though you probably could.
